District Six Museum
Cape Town, South Africa
Discovery the heart-tugging history of the community evicted from District Six during the time of apartheid.
The District Six Museum is an insightful account into a once vibrant community of merchants, artisans, labourers and immigrants. In 1966 District Six was declared a "white group area" by the National Party government, causing thousands of coloured residents to be forced out into a periphery area known as the Cape Flats, while the community buildings and home were demolished.
